The Purpose and Function of Labelling Machines
Labelling machines are specialized equipment designed to apply labels onto products or packaging in a consistent and efficient manner. These machines automate the process of labeling, replacing manual labor and eliminating human error. The primary function of a labelling machine is to accurately affix labels that carry vital information such as product details, barcodes, expiration dates, and branding elements onto various items.
Types of Labelling Machines
Labelling machines come in a variety of types, each tailored to specific applications and requirements. The main types of labelling machines include:
1. Pressure-Sensitive Labellers:
Pressure-sensitive labellers are among the most common types of labelling machines. They utilize pressure-sensitive labels that adhere to products or packaging when pressure is applied. These machines are versatile and can handle a wide range of label sizes and shapes.
2. Wrap-Around Labellers:
Wrap-around labellers are ideal for cylindrical products such as bottles or cans. They wrap labels around the entire circumference of the product, providing ample space for product information and branding.
3. Sleeve Labellers:
Sleeve labellers apply shrink sleeves or stretch sleeves to products, creating a 360-degree label coverage. These machines are commonly used for products that require tamper-evident packaging or enhanced visual appeal.
4. Print-and-Apply Labellers:
Print-and-apply labellers are equipped with printers that can print labels on demand before applying them to products. These machines are suitable for applications that require variable data printing or unique identification codes.
Applications of Labelling Machines
Labelling machines find widespread applications across various industries, including but not limited to:
1. Food and Beverage Industry:
In the food and beverage industry, labelling machines are used to apply nutritional information, ingredients, and packaging dates on products to comply with regulatory standards and ensure consumer safety.
2. Pharmaceutical Industry:
Pharmaceutical companies rely on labelling machines to accurately label medication bottles, vials, and packaging with dosage instructions, warnings, and barcodes for traceability.
3. Cosmetics Industry:
In the cosmetics industry, labelling machines are employed to apply attractive labels with visually appealing designs, product details, and brand logos to enhance product presentation and consumer appeal.
4. Automotive Industry:
Automotive manufacturers use labelling machines to affix labels with vehicle identification numbers (VINs), manufacturing dates, and safety information on car parts and components for tracking and quality control purposes.
The Benefits of Using Labelling Machines
Utilizing labelling machines in your manufacturing or production process offers a myriad of benefits, including:
1. Improved Efficiency:
Labelling machines automate the labeling process, increasing production speed and reducing labor costs. This leads to improved operational efficiency and faster time-to-market for products.
2. Enhanced Accuracy:
By eliminating human error associated with manual labeling, labelling machines ensure consistent label placement and alignment, reducing the risk of mislabeling and product recalls.
3. Regulatory Compliance:
Labelling machines help companies adhere to strict regulatory requirements by accurately labeling products with essential information such as ingredients, expiration dates, and safety warnings.
4. Brand Consistency:
Consistent and professionally applied labels enhance brand recognition and consumer trust. Labelling machines ensure that all products are labeled with uniformity, reinforcing brand consistency across the product line.
Best Practices for Optimizing Labelling Machine Performance
To maximize the performance and longevity of your labelling machine, consider implementing the following best practices:
1. Regular Maintenance:
Perform routine maintenance checks on your labelling machine to ensure all components are in optimal working condition. Clean the machine regularly and inspect for any signs of wear or damage.
2. Proper Training:
Provide comprehensive training to operators on how to operate the labelling machine effectively and troubleshoot common issues. Proper training minimizes downtime and improves overall efficiency.
3. Quality Control Measures:
Implement quality control measures to verify the accuracy and placement of labels applied by the machine. Conduct regular quality checks to detect any inconsistencies or defects in the labeling process.
4. Use High-Quality Labels:
Invest in high-quality labels that are compatible with your labelling machine to ensure smooth application and longevity. Poor-quality labels can jam the machine or result in label misalignment.
